Overview
Pomare School is a state contributing school in Taita, Wellington. It is a co-educational school. The school has 89 students on the roll. Its Equity Index (EQI) is 515 (high equity need). The school does not have an enrolment scheme. It is located in the Lower Hutt City territorial authority.

Equity Index (EQI)
The Equity Index replaced the decile system in 2023. It measures the socio-economic context of a school's student community. A higher EQI indicates greater equity need (more disadvantaged). The national average is approximately 463.
